Mellanox Appoints Alinka Flaminia as Senior Vice President and General Counsel

September 19, 2016

SUNNYVALE, Calif. and YOKNEAM, Israel, Sept. 19 — Mellanox Technologies, Ltd. (NASDAQ: MLNX), a leading supplier of high-performance, end-to-end interconnect solutions for data center servers and storage systems, today announced the appointment of Alinka Flaminia as its Senior Vice President and General Counsel assuming responsibility for the Company’s global legal affairs, public policy interests and compliance operations. She will report directly to Eyal Waldman, President and CEO of Mellanox Technologies, as a member of the Company’s executive staff. It is also anticipated that Ms. Flaminia will serve as the Company’s Corporate Secretary. In addition, Gideon Rosenberg, Vice President of Legal Affairs, has been promoted to Deputy General Counsel and VP of Legal Affairs.

Alinka Flaminia, Mellanox Technologies, Senior Vice President and General Counsel (Photo: Business W ...  Ms. Flaminia brings to Mellanox more than 25 years of diverse legal experience with technology companies, most recently serving as vice president, General Counsel and Corporate Secretary of PMC-Sierra, Inc., from 2007 to 2016. Ms. Flaminia held corporate and other in-house legal roles as Senior Counsel at Xilinx, Inc., and prior to this, was Manager of Legal Affairs at Network Associates, Inc. (McAfee). In her decade of private practice, Ms. Flaminia represented technology companies on corporate and litigation matters. Ms. Flaminia received her Doctorate of Law (J.D.) from the University of Colorado and her Bachelor of Arts from Yale University.

Gideon Rosenberg joined Mellanox in 2010 and was appointed Vice President, Legal Affairs, in 2013. Mr. Rosenberg has been responsible for overseeing all of Mellanox’s legal matters since December 2013, including managing the acquisition of EZchip Semiconductors and the associated loan. Prior to that, Mr. Rosenberg was Sr. Counsel and Director of Israeli Compliance responsible for Mellanox’s Israeli, EMEA, and Asia legal affairs and corporate governance. Prior to joining Mellanox, Mr. Rosenberg was general counsel and company secretary of McKesson Israel Ltd. (formerly Medcon Ltd.). He has also served as the President of the Israeli Chapter of the Association of Corporate Counsel. Mr. Rosenberg graduated with an LL.B, with honors, from the University College London.
